The Science and Art of Emotion
Before diving into the practical applications of a random emotion generator, it's worth considering the psychological underpinnings of emotion itself. Psychologists like Paul Ekman have identified universal facial expressions associated with core emotions, suggesting a biological basis for many of our feelings. However, the context in which these emotions arise, the intensity with which they are felt, and the ways they are expressed are all deeply influenced by culture, personal history, and individual temperament.
Consider the subtle difference between annoyance and fury, or between contentment and ecstatic joy. These aren't just simple on/off switches; they exist on a continuum, often blending and morphing into one another. A truly compelling character isn't just "happy" or "sad"; they might be "wistfully nostalgic," "nervously optimistic," or "bitterly resigned." Generating these nuanced emotional states can be challenging, but a well-designed random emotion generator can provide prompts that push creators beyond the obvious.
How a Random Emotion Generator Fuels Creativity
So, how exactly does a tool designed to generate random emotions benefit the creative process? It's all about breaking patterns and introducing novelty.
1. Overcoming Creative Blocks
Every artist, writer, or designer has experienced the dreaded creative block. When inspiration seems to have dried up, a random emotion generator can act as a powerful catalyst. By presenting an unexpected emotional state, it forces you to think differently.
- For Writers: Imagine you're writing a scene where your protagonist is meeting a long-lost friend. Instead of the expected joy or awkwardness, the generator might suggest "resentful nostalgia." How does this change the interaction? Does the protagonist mask their true feelings? Does a subtle barb slip out? This unexpected prompt can lead to a far more compelling and complex scene than a predictable emotional response.
- For Artists: If you're sketching a portrait and are stuck on conveying a specific mood, a random emotion like "wary curiosity" or "melancholy amusement" can guide your brushstrokes, facial expressions, and even the lighting choices. It pushes you to interpret the emotion visually, rather than defaulting to a common trope.
- For Game Developers: When designing character AI or narrative events, a random emotion can add depth and unpredictability. A normally stoic NPC might suddenly exhibit "embarrassed contrition" after a player's action, leading to a more dynamic and engaging gameplay experience.
2. Exploring Uncharted Emotional Territories
We all have our go-to emotional palettes. Some writers excel at depicting anger, while others are masters of melancholy. A random emotion generator encourages you to step outside your comfort zone and explore feelings you might not typically gravitate towards. This can lead to a richer, more diverse portfolio of emotional expression in your work.
Think about characters who are typically portrayed as one-dimensional. A villain who experiences a fleeting moment of "vulnerable hope," or a hero who grapples with "petty jealousy." These unexpected emotional flashes can humanize characters, adding layers of complexity that make them more memorable and relatable, even if they are antagonists.
3. Enhancing Character Depth and Realism
Real people are rarely emotionally consistent. We experience a jumble of feelings simultaneously, and our outward expressions don't always match our internal states. A random emotion generator can help you simulate this authentic complexity.
- Internal Monologue: A character might feel "exasperated" with a situation but outwardly project "calm determination." The generator can provide the internal conflict, which a writer can then explore through inner thoughts and subtle behavioral cues.
- Subtext in Dialogue: A character might say, "That's fine," with an underlying emotion of "bitter disappointment." The generator can provide the subtext, allowing the writer to craft dialogue that is layered and meaningful.
- Unpredictable Reactions: In a game or interactive story, a character's reaction to an event could be influenced by a randomly generated emotion, making the world feel more alive and less predictable. For instance, a character might react to a minor setback with "unwarranted panic" due to a randomly assigned "anxiety" modifier.
4. Generating Unique Scenarios and Plot Twists
Sometimes, the most compelling stories arise from unexpected emotional catalysts. A random emotion generator can be a fantastic tool for brainstorming plot points.
- What if a character's sudden outburst of "uncontrollable laughter" at a somber occasion reveals a hidden coping mechanism or a deep-seated unease?
- How does a character navigate a critical negotiation when they are experiencing "crippling self-doubt" that they must conceal?
- Imagine a romantic comedy where one character's persistent "playful teasing" is actually a manifestation of "deep-seated insecurity."
These prompts can lead to surprising narrative turns and character developments that elevate your work from ordinary to extraordinary.
Practical Applications and Examples
Let's look at some concrete ways a random emotion generator can be implemented across different creative disciplines.
For Writers:
- Character Development: Assign a core "random emotion" to a character for a specific scene or even as a dominant personality trait. For example, a character might be defined by "wistful longing," influencing their dialogue, actions, and internal thoughts.
- Dialogue Prompts: Use the generator to add unexpected emotional subtext to conversations. If two characters are discussing a mundane topic, what if one is secretly feeling "smug satisfaction" or "mounting dread"?
- Scene Setting: Infuse a scene with a particular atmosphere by assigning an emotion to the environment itself, as perceived by a character. A forest might evoke "ancient melancholy," or a bustling city street might feel "overwhelmingly chaotic joy."
For Visual Artists:
- Facial Expressions: Practice drawing a range of emotions beyond the basic happy/sad/angry. Try to capture "wry amusement," "guarded optimism," or "weary resignation" on a character's face.
- Body Language: Translate abstract emotions into physical poses. How would someone convey "nervous anticipation" or "smug superiority" through their posture and gestures?
- Color Palettes and Lighting: Associate specific emotions with color schemes and lighting techniques. "Melancholy" might suggest cool blues and muted grays, while "frenzied excitement" could call for vibrant reds and dynamic lighting.
For Game Designers:
- NPC Behavior: Randomly assign emotional states to non-player characters to create more dynamic and believable interactions. An NPC might react to a player's presence with "suspicious curiosity" or "friendly deference."
- Event Triggers: Use emotions as triggers for specific game events or dialogue branches. If a character's emotional state shifts to "overwhelming fear," they might flee the scene or seek help.
- Player Feedback: Incorporate subtle visual or auditory cues that reflect a character's randomly generated emotional state, providing players with richer feedback on the game world.
The Nuances of Randomness
It's important to note that "random" doesn't necessarily mean "nonsensical." A truly effective random emotion generator might incorporate elements of psychological theory or common emotional associations. For instance, it might generate:
- Complex Emotions: Instead of just "sad," it might offer "bittersweet nostalgia," "melancholy resignation," or "disappointed hope."
- Mixed Emotions: Characters rarely feel just one thing. The generator could provide combinations like "anxious excitement" or "angry confusion."
- Intensity Levels: Emotions can range from mild to extreme. A generator might include modifiers for intensity, such as "mild annoyance" versus "seething rage."
The goal isn't to create arbitrary emotional states, but to provide prompts that are specific enough to be actionable yet broad enough to allow for creative interpretation.
Potential Pitfalls and How to Avoid Them
While a random emotion generator is a powerful tool, it's not a magic bullet. Here are a few potential pitfalls and how to navigate them:
- Over-reliance: Don't let the generator dictate your entire creative vision. Use it as a springboard, not a crutch. Always filter the generated emotions through your understanding of the character, story, and overall tone.
- Misinterpretation: A generated emotion might seem strange or out of place at first glance. Take the time to explore why a character might feel that way. What internal or external factors could lead to this emotional state? This is often where the most interesting creative discoveries lie.
- Lack of Context: A single generated emotion is just a starting point. Consider how it fits into the broader emotional arc of a character or scene. Is it a fleeting feeling, or a more deeply ingrained trait?
